13 Bedroom Semi-Detached House for Sale£585,000Chapel Road, Meonstoke, SO32Property TypeSemi-Detached HouseBedrooms× 3
13 Bedroom Semi-Detached House for Sale£585,000Chapel Road, Meonstoke, SO32Property TypeSemi-Detached HouseBedrooms× 3